+ def test_egg_info_save_version_info_setup_empty(self, tmpdir_cwd, env):
+ """
+ When the egg_info section is empty or not present, running
+ save_version_info should add the settings to the setup.cfg
+ in a deterministic order, consistent with the ordering found
+ on Python 2.6 and 2.7 with PYTHONHASHSEED=0.
+ """
+ setup_cfg = os.path.join(env.paths['home'], 'setup.cfg')
+ dist = Distribution()
+ ei = egg_info(dist)
+ ei.initialize_options()
+ ei.save_version_info(setup_cfg)
+
+ with open(setup_cfg, 'r') as f:
+ content = f.read()
+
+ assert '[egg_info]' in content
+ assert 'tag_build =' in content
+ assert 'tag_date = 0' in content
+ assert 'tag_svn_revision = 0' in content
+
+ expected_order = 'tag_build', 'tag_date', 'tag_svn_revision'
+
+ self._validate_content_order(content, expected_order)
+
+ @staticmethod
+ def _validate_content_order(content, expected):
+ """
+ Assert that the strings in expected appear in content
+ in order.
+ """
+ if sys.version_info < (2, 7):
+ # On Python 2.6, expect dict key order.
+ expected = dict.fromkeys(expected).keys()
+
+ pattern = '.*'.join(expected)
+ flags = re.MULTILINE | re.DOTALL
+ assert re.search(pattern, content, flags)
+
